DIANE'S SHORT BIO: 

National bestselling author Diane Vallere writes stylish, character-driven mysteries that blend clever clues, sharp wit, and heart. Her stories span contemporary small towns, the glamorous mid-century past, and retro-inflected worlds, all anchored by strong voices and sparkling intrigue. 

She is the editor of the Agatha Award–winning essay collection Promophobia: Taking the Mystery out of Promoting Crime Fiction. Diane studied art history at the College of William and Mary and spent years in luxury retail before trading fashion accessories for accessories to murder. 

She currently resides in Pennsylvania.

DIANE'S FULL BIO: 

National bestselling author Diane Vallere writes witty, character-driven mysteries known for their clever clues, sharp humor, and stylish sensibility. Her work spans contemporary small towns, the glamorous mid-century past, and retro-inflected worlds, all anchored by strong voices and sparkling intrigue. Her series include the Material Witness, Madison Night, Killer Fashion Mysteries, and the Sylvia Stryker Outer Space adventures. 

Diane is the editor of the Agatha Award–winning essay collection Promophobia: Taking the Mystery out of Promoting Crime Fiction and has contributed short fiction to numerous anthologies, including “Tread Man Walking” in Murder in the Air: A Destination Murders Short Story Collection and “We Don’t Get Along” in Murder-A-Go-Go’s: Crime Fiction Inspired by the Music of the Go-Go’s (Down & Out Books). 

A past president of both the national and Los Angeles chapters of Sisters in Crime, Diane remains an active member of the Delaware Valley chapter. She has served as co-chair of the California Crime Writers Conference and is a frequent participant in mystery conferences including Malice Domestic, Bouchercon, Left Coast Crime, New England Crime Bake, the Writers Police Academy, and Homicide School for Writers. She is also a member of the Historical Novel Society, International Thriller Writers, Independent Book Publishers Association, the Planetary Society, and Sisters in Crime. 

Diane holds a BA in Fine Arts from the College of William and Mary and spent more than twenty years working in luxury retail before trading fashion accessories for accessories to murder. After living in Dallas and Los Angeles, she now resides in Pennsylvania, where she enjoys classic films and cheering for Philly sports.
